This reaction is called Hydrolysis of Amides. Amides are carboxylic acid derivatives where the -OH of the carboxylic acid has been replaced by -NH2, -NHR, or -NR2 of an amine. Since the reaction between a carboxylic acid and an amine to give an amide also liberates water, this is an example of a "condensation reaction".

To transport the substance inside the cell when the concentration inside the cell is already higher than outside the cell would require active transport because the substance would be moving against its concentration gradient.
